Mileage & Performance: Efficient Power for Every Ride
The heart of the Classic 350 Heritage Premium is its refined 349cc, single-cylinder, 4-stroke, air-oil cooled engine. This J-series engine delivers a smooth power output of approximately 20.2 bhp at 6100 rpm and a robust torque of 27 Nm at 4000 rpm. It’s engineered for both spirited city rides and relaxed highway cruising.
Regarding efficiency, the Royal Enfield Classic 350 Heritage Premium mileage is quite impressive for its segment, typically offering around 35-40 km/l under mixed riding conditions. This makes it an economical choice for daily commutes and long-distance tours alike. Dimensions & Capacity: Built for Comfort and Presence
Standing tall with a commanding presence, the Classic 350 Heritage Premium features well-balanced dimensions. Its generous wheelbase of 1390 mm ensures stability, while the ground clearance of 170 mm tackles varied Indian road conditions with ease. ‘Royal Enfield Classic 350 Heritage Premium’ Variants and Specifications
This description focuses exclusively on the Royal Enfield Classic 350 Heritage Premium. It stands as a unique, single-trim offering.
Engine & Performance: It is powered by Royal Enfield’s acclaimed J-series engine. This is a 349cc, single-cylinder, 4-stroke, air-oil cooled petrol engine. It delivers smooth, tractable power. The engine produces approximately 20.2 bhp (14.87 kW) of maximum power. Its peak torque stands at 27 Nm. These figures ensure a relaxed yet capable acceleration.
Transmission & Mileage: Power reaches the wheels via a smooth 5-speed constant mesh gearbox. Royal Enfield claims an impressive mileage of around 36.2 kmpl. This provides a good balance of performance and fuel efficiency.
Chassis & Suspension: The frame is a twin downtube spine chassis. Suspension duties are handled by 41mm telescopic front forks. Twin tube emulsion shock absorbers with 6-step preload adjustment are at the rear.
Features and Technology
The Classic 350 Heritage Premium integrates essential modern features. Safety is a prime concern, addressed by a dual-channel Anti-lock Braking System (ABS). This ensures stable and effective stopping power in diverse conditions. Comfort is a significant highlight, with a well-padded, wide seat. Its upright, comfortable riding posture significantly reduces rider fatigue. This makes both short and long rides enjoyable. Convenience features include a digital-analog instrument cluster. This provides crucial ride information like fuel level and trip meters. A USB charging port is often included, adding practicality for modern riders. The robust metal body parts emphasize superior build quality, contributing to a stable and confidence-inspiring ride.

Competitors of ‘Royal Enfield Classic 350 Heritage Premium’ in India
The Royal Enfield Classic 350 Heritage Premium operates in a highly competitive segment. Its close rivals include the Honda H'ness CB350 and the Jawa 350. Another significant contender is the Benelli Imperiale 400. These models also offer a similar retro styling and engine displacement. They primarily target buyers prioritizing classic aesthetics, comfort, and a strong brand legacy. Competition often hinges on factors like pricing, unique features, brand service network, and individual rider preferences for specific styling cues.
